T-Mobile US Inc. 6.250% Senior Notes due 2069 (TMUSL) represent debt obligations issued by T-Mobile US, Inc., a major telecommunications company. Unlike common equity securities, fixed-income instruments such as senior notes do not report traditional earnings metrics like EPS or revenue.
